Acer Android mobile phone: Rumor or Truth

It looks like Boy Genius’ smart radar caught a photo of an upcoming Acer mobile phone. What’s blurry besides the photo is whether the cell phone, which might be announced in the upcoming Mobile World Congress this February, is powered by Android or not. The Acer mobile phone has a sliding keyboard and … that’s about it for now on the specs I guess.

We’ll just have to wait until next week when the Mobile World Congress opens up in Barcelona, Spain.
